☐ Ceremony item 12 — Pagination signing key (Corvet API). Reviewer: confirm the cursor-token signing key for the public REST API's pagination endpoints is rotated during this ceremony. Old tokens expire in 24h; clients using page offsets are unaffected. Verify quorum of three officers present, dual-log the rotation, and seal the previous key. Decrypting the sealed key envelope, if rollback is ever required, needs the recovery passphrase below.

unlock words, tawif-tahop: oliys-ulawyn-tamdor-lamys-casox-jormir-fraius-kasath-ulador-ulamir-holir-sorys-holeth

## Service Accounts — StormFan Alert Fan-Out

The fan-out worker authenticates to the internal dispatch tier using the svc-stormfan account. Rotate quarterly; scopes are limited to publish-only on alert topics. If deliveries stall during your shift, verify the worker is using the current credential, reproduced below for reference.

API key for kaweg-hahif: kto4_rAjZ

Handover note — Crumbwheel order cutoffs.

Welcome aboard. The bakery cutoff rule in Crumbwheel closes same-day orders at 14:00 local to each storefront, not UTC — this has bitten us twice. Holiday overrides live in the calendar service and take precedence silently, so always check there first when a cutoff looks wrong. To unlock the calendar service's admin console after a restart, enter the recovery passphrase below.

vault phrase of bagap-bahaf = silion-pelox-sorox-casdor-quenwyn-fraax-eliox-praael-kelion-quenvan-kasox-rusael-norius-belvan